    For anyone with a very slow leak into the toilet bowl with a Novelli cistern, check the washers in both halves of the inlet valve when it's apart (as shown in this video). Mine just had a couple tiny flakes of PVC preventing it from sealing properly. Even when it's a very tight fit in the right side of the cistern, first remove the flush valve by turning the main body a couple clicks and pulling it up, that way you can hold the base of the inlet valve to remove it, there's just enough room.
